## Broker Upgrade Notes

Quillbus 4.x drops support for the legacy fanout config used by Marrowtide services. Before upgrading, drain the retry queues and snapshot the offsets table. Upgrade brokers one at a time; consumers reconnect automatically but producers need a restart. Rollback is only safe within 24 hours, before log compaction runs. The full upgrade runbook, including version pinning rules, lives on the internal page here.

wiki page, bawef-hafop: https://jira.nelvroworks.corp/job/pages/projects/7c5c0f440dbd

## Canary Gating, the Short Version

When you push a Larkspin canary, the gate watches error rate, p95 latency, and checkout conversion for 30 minutes. Any metric breaching its budget auto-rolls back — don't override unless the Deploy captain signs off. Thresholds change quarterly, so don't memorize them. The current gating rules are kept on the internal page below.

operations page: https://jenkins.zemvarcloud.local/job/merge_requests/repo/build/73930b4b30f0a8ed

Quarterly Planning Note — Reseller Programme

For Q2, the Lanthorn reseller programme expands from pilot to twelve partners across the Vessmark corridor. Margin tiers remain as agreed: 18% base, 24% on certified installations. Ariane Kolt will own partner onboarding, with training materials due by week six. Heads of department should flag channel conflicts early. Strategic context appears immediately below.

management briefing: Project Ulavan slips by two quarters because of the staffing delay.